§ 6708. Definition of practice of veterinary technology.

1.The\npractice of the profession of veterinary technology is defined as the\nperformance of services within the field of veterinary medicine by a\nperson who, for compensation or personal profit, is employed by or under\nthe supervision of a veterinarian to perform such duties as are required\nin carrying out medical orders as prescribed by a licensed veterinarian\nrequiring an understanding of veterinary science, but not requiring\nprofessional service as set forth in section sixty-seven hundred one of\nthis article.\n 2. The commissioner shall promulgate regulations defining the\nfunctions an veterinary technician may perform that are consistent with\nthe training and qualifications for a license as an veterinary\ntechnician.
